【技术实现步骤摘要】
基于决策树的决策行为生成方法及系统
本专利技术涉及数据处理和数据挖掘的方法及系统,具体讲是基于决策树的决策行为生成方法及系统。
技术介绍
决策树是一种基于树形结构的机器学习方法。由于每个人的行为都有一定的行为依据,因此可以利用决策树将人的行为进行分析,进而得出相应的决策行为依据,这种方法在当前互联网领域的应用越来越广泛。决策树具有较好的可解释性,能够有效帮助决策者进行决策分析,被广泛应用于银行信贷建模工作中。建模人员可以通过手工配置树形结构、配置从属关系,进而得到一个决策树。常用的决策树构建工具如SAS,属于单机交互式建模工具,主要特点是可以通过自定义配置实现数据建模,需要建模人员手工单个节点构建决策树,构建时间长,可处理少量数据,不支持批量数据分析。利用分布式存储的训练数据进行交互式建模虽然可以解决单机交互式建模数据处理量少的问题,但不能真正解决决策结果高效、准确的要求。随着消费信贷业务的爆发式发展,信贷业务已进入存量管理阶段,如何精细化运营和管理好庞大的存量客户,是银行贷中工作的重点,需要对存量客 ...
【技术保护点】
1.基于决策树的决策行为生成方法,其特征包括:/nS1.通过处理器从客户信息中进行特征提取,得到供决策树应用的指标,然后通过对指标进行表达式正确性校验,得到可用指标;/nS2.新建决策树上的单一节点,每个单一节点都具有唯一性的节点编码,通过所述的可用指标对各单一节点进行参数配置,再根据各单一节点的类型、节点编码和输入/输出参数将所有单一节点相互形成父/子关系,其中,单一节点的类型包括开始节点、分支节点、规则节点和叶子节点,其中叶子节点没有子节点,每个子节点的输入参数是其父节点的输出参数;/nS3.对具有父子关系的节点分别进行条件配置,得到配置完整的决策路径,每条决策路径的叶 ...
【技术特征摘要】
1.基于决策树的决策行为生成方法,其特征包括:
S1.通过处理器从客户信息中进行特征提取,得到供决策树应用的指标,然后通过对指标进行表达式正确性校验,得到可用指标;
S2.新建决策树上的单一节点,每个单一节点都具有唯一性的节点编码,通过所述的可用指标对各单一节点进行参数配置,再根据各单一节点的类型、节点编码和输入/输出参数将所有单一节点相互形成父/子关系,其中,单一节点的类型包括开始节点、分支节点、规则节点和叶子节点,其中叶子节点没有子节点,每个子节点的输入参数是其父节点的输出参数;
S3.对具有父子关系的节点分别进行条件配置,得到配置完整的决策路径,每条决策路径的叶子节点都具有表示决策行为的决策行动码,然后对配置完整的决策路径进行正确性校验,得到决策树;
S4.通过样本数据进行决策树预跑批,得到决策树预跑批结果,对决策树预跑批结果进行数据验证后,得到可用决策树;
S5.通过预先配置时间定时器或预先获取指标值来对可用决策树的跑批始点进行配置,得到决策树跑批任务,进而得到决策树版本;
S6.通过对决策树版本进行配置,得到系统应用的决策树,然后通过系统应用的决策树进行决策树跑批任务,得到可立即执行的决策行为。
2.如权利要求1所述的基于决策树的决策行为生成方法,其特征为:步骤S1中,通过处理器对客户信息进行结构化、半结构化和非结构化字段的解析、抽取和计算,得到基础指标,再通过数学运算符对基础指标进行数值表达式配置,得到衍生指标,基础指标和衍生指标共同构成所述的供决策树应用的指标。
3.如权利要求1所述的基于决策树的决策行为生成方法,其特征为:步骤S2中所述的通过所述的可用指标对各单一节点进行参数配置,是通过逻辑表达式将不同的可用指标进行关联。
4.如权利要求1所述的基于决策树的决策行为生成方法,其特征为:在决策树中各单一节点之间的父/子关系为:
开始节点:无父节点,子节点只能为分支节点和/或规则节点;在决策树上有且只有1个;
分支节点:父节点为开始节点、分支节点或规则节点;至少有一个子节点,子节点为分支节点、规则节点和/或叶子节点;在决策树上至少有1个;
规则节点:父节点为开始节点、分支节点或规则节点;有且只有一个子节点,子节点为分支节点、规则节点或叶子节点;在决策树上至少有1个;
叶子节点:父节点为分支节点或规则节点,后面无子节点,是决策...
【专利技术属性】
技术研发人员:姜文玲,卫浩,彭恒,
申请(专利权)人:四川新网银行股份有限公司,
类型:发明
国别省市:四川;51
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。